Is It Real? Penhaligon Halfeti Leather
9/10/26
Okay, this one has me in a bit of a conundrum. I got it massively on sale (from where I don’t remember) and it arrived in it’s pretty packaging. But when I tried it, a big meh. To the point where I am not sure that I wasn’t diddled. It definitely has a scent to it: woody pencils in a leather case. It has decent throw (for a Penhaligon, I suppose)
From Frangrantica: Halfeti was launched in 2015. The nose behind this fragrance is Christian Provenzano. Top notes are Cypress Leaf, Saffron, Cardamom, Artemisia, Bergamot and Grapefruit; middle notes are Bulgarian Rose, Nutmeg and Jasmine; base notes are Agarwood (Oud), Cedar, Leather, Sandalwood, Amber, Tonka Bean, Vanilla and Musk.

Well, I got a sample from StC and it’s the same. Strong sandalwood (remember that dig about “too much sandalwood for a woman with her face” in Capote versus the Swans?) and pencil shavings. Which means that it is (to me at least) just not very interesting.
You can get it for scandalously low prices on the interwebs where I got it, or you can pay over $300 at Bloomingdales. Samples are available at Surrender to Chance.
